Preparation

Preparation

1. Preheat the Oven

Preheat your oven to 300°F (150°C).

2. Season the Ribs

Rub the baby back ribs with salt, black p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, and paprika. Drizzle with olive oil and massage the seasoning into the meat.

Cooking

3. Braise the Ribs

Place the seasoned ribs on a baking sheet, cover tightly with aluminum foil, and braise in the preheated oven for 2.5 to 3 hours, or until tender.

4. Make the BBQ Sauce

In a saucepan, combine ketchup, brown sugar, apple cider vinegar, Worcestershire sauce, smoked paprika, garlic powder, salt, and black pepper. Simmer on low heat for about 20 minutes, stirring occasionally.

5. Glaze the Ribs

Remove the ribs from the oven and discard the foil. Brush a generous amount of BBQ sauce over the ribs. Increase the oven temperature to 400°F (200°C) and bake for an additional 15-20 minutes to caramelize the sauce.

Serving

6. Serve

Remove the ribs from the oven, let them rest for a few minutes, then slice and serve with additional BBQ sauce on the side.
